Local craft beer brewers from Malt Fiction have been awarded three silvers and one bronze in the world’s largest annual beer competition, the Australian International Beer Awards (AIBA), held in Melbourne Thursday, May 19 2016.

Malt Fiction was awarded silver for ‘Best International Pale Ale,’ ‘Best Packaging (labels/surface graphic on cans)’ and ‘Best Packaging (consumer retail packaging/outer case)’ for their Session Ale. As well as taking out bronze for ‘Best American Style International Pale Ale’ for their draught IPA.

Head brewer of Malt Fiction, Jared Birbeck, says, “Out of 1,700 entries from 350 brewers and breweries, Malt Fiction has proven to be one of the best having been awarded so highly.

“The AIBA promotes brewing excellence in Australia and around the globe and we are thrilled that Malt Fiction has been recognized for prestigious awards such as these,” says Jared Birbeck.

Judged by a panel of high calibre experts with extensive experience across the beer industry, the AIBA honours packaged and draught beer that not only boast excellence in their product, but in their presentation as well.

“Our graphic designer, James Hopgood, has done an outstanding job to ensure the appearance of our beers complements our product perfectly,” says Jared Birbeck.

Established in 2014, Malt Fiction now has four awards up their sleeves for their brew ‘Session Ale’, with the hopes of many more successful brews to come.
